-Carving Out My Name-
by
Keaton Foster

Naked
Bare
Steady the hand
A skilled man
Down upon one knee
Adequate force applied
Marking out letters
Dates of the beginning
Certifications of the end
Crude, but effective
Carving out my name
On a heavy stone
That was just there
Waiting, ready
Who placed it
Quite unclear
Immovable
Impossible
Forever and ever
It will be
A marker of me
The end of the line
No one else’s
But mine
Some will come
Just a few
A handful of strangers
Obligated out of sadness
They could not allow a man
Such as I to face the end alone
Standing there in uncomfortable poses
They will say nothing
So will I
Carving out my name
Marking my place
Setting who I was
Into stone
Kind lies
Will be truthfully lent
A servant of God
Will speak on my behalf
Ignorant and blind
Are those who knew me
In such a moment of time
They will let him carry on
When he is done
The reality of all that I’ve done
Will come back full on
Cursed in life
Blessed in death
Hypocrisy reigns supreme
Amen will be said
Something I myself
Never truly meant
Flowers will be placed
Then forever all who came
Will turn and walk away
I will eternally remain
As motionless as the stone
That will shows those alive
Where it is I have gone…
